   >The history of the Samaritan people might be said to begin after 997   
   >B.C., when the northern ten tribes of Israel under the leadership of   
   >Jeroboam revolted against the rule of the house of David. Some fifty   
   >years afterward, King Omri, of the ten-tribe kingdom, bought the   
   >mountain of Samaria from Shemer and on it built the city of Samaria,   
   >which became the capital of Israel. After that the people of Israel,   
   >especially those from Samaria, came to be called Samaritans, and the   
   >whole northern territory, Samaria.-1 Ki. 16:23, 24; Hos. 8:5; 2 Ki.   
   >17:29.The term "Samaritans" first appeared in Scripture after the   
   >conquest of the ten-tribe kingdom of Samaria in 740 B.C.E.; it was   
   >applied to those who lived in the northern kingdom before that conquest   
   >as distinct from the foreigners later brought in from other parts of   
   >the Assyrian Empire. (2Ki 17:29) It appears that the Assyrians did not   
   >remove all the Israelite inhabitants, for the account at 2 Chronicles   
   >34:6-9 (compare 2Ki 23:19, 20) implies that during King Josiah's   
   >reign there were Israelites still in the land. In time,   
   >"Samaritans" came to mean the descendants of those left in Samaria   
   >and those brought in by the Assyrians.
